About Brown Carrick Hill

Brown Carrick Hill is a summit in the region or range in Scotland. Brown Carrick Hill is 287 metres high. All the walking routes up Brown Carrick Hill on Mud and Routes can be found below. The top can be identified by the small rock by trig point. Other Notes: 0.13m higher than grassy mound 240m NE at NS 28586 16030, 0.2m higher than ground 120m E at NS 28483 15944 and all other ground lower.

Brown Carrick Hill Summit Stats

Height in Metres: 287.5 metres

Height in Feet: 943 feet

Range: Ayr to the River Clyde

Prominence: 229 metres

Parent Summit:

Grid Reference: NS283159

Col Height: 59

Col Grid Reference: NS314091

Summit Classification: Marilyn Hills In the UK, Tumps 200-299m
